Several major US companies, including Nintendo, Amazon, and Apple, are experiencing a boost in quarterly earnings due to tariff refunds. Amazon reported receiving $600 million, while Apple noted an increase of $0.11 in diluted earnings per share. This trend follows the Supreme Court striking down tariffs, resulting in $100 billion returned. Meanwhile, Senator Elizabeth Warren is urging these corporations to share the windfall by returning the refunded money directly to their customers.
